Mission 3 Debrief:
Objective: Infiltrate the northern peninusla at coordinates [redacted] via H.A.L.O. deployment. Proceed to and perform reconnaissance on the archeo-site at coordinates [redacted]. Report all findings to command and await further orders. You must remain tactically flexible on this mission, adjust your wargear loadout accordingly. Extraction will be by air.
There are reports of possible rebel forces in the area, as well as Orkoid settlements less than 50 clicks south of the position. Be on your guard.
Critical Parameter: Leave no witnesses; All other forces must not survive contact with your team. May be countermanded by HQ.
Optional Parameter: Targets of Opportunity; Orkoid leaders, Rebel leaders, enemy intel or communications.
The H.A.L.O deployment to the peninsula went smoothly and no losses occurred during the drop.
The team was immediately discovered however by a Freebooter Orkoid squad of apparent high quality. The situation was handled with diplomatic grace and the Freebooters were turned as allies for the duration of the mission. Their military assistance and planetary intel was exchanged for restricted looting rights, and safe passage off the planet. This was deemed acceptable. The intel gained was worth much more than the Greenskins realized.

The scout team then planned and executed a combined assault on what turned out to be a major excavation project, being conducted by Noble House [redacted] confirming our suspicions of their involvement. Scout Atash utilized a commandeered orkoid vehicle to apprehend the project leader. The matter has been turned over to the Adeptus Arbites for recommendations.
Once the position had been secured and the Greenskins had departed, the scout team was extracted. Recovery and excavation crew have been deployed, along with the Chryos 1st Company 6th Platoon to secure the archeo-site.
HANDLERS NOTE:
Scout Lance is scheduled for aerial assault retraining. Before he leaves a permanent, career ending indentation upon the ground.
The ability to assess a poor situation and extract a favorable outcome is a survival trait we of the Tempest Knights pride ourselves on.
To successfully negotiate a strategically advantageous agreement, while you back is literally against a cliff and outnumbered 10.5 to one by well equipped Blood Axe commandos is worthy of recording in the Chapter Annuls. Which we have now done. Scout Tarsonis is now one of the few external Astartes to be entered into our Holy Tomes Diplomatic.
Not sure what to make of Scout Atash. He swings from barely capable to a battle-field improvisational genius. I must strongly advise a personnel review be carried out by Chaplain Kathay as soon as possible.
The thrice cursed Great Enemy has been confirmed on this world. We suspected some of the Traitor legions might be involved in this attempted coop, and now we know for sure. The Heralds of Change are here. We had counted them destroyed thanks to the Shadowed Suns, but it would appear they still live. At least a good number of them met a bloody end though. The sheer number of weaponry displaying their iconography that the Freebooters had with them suggest at least 30 of their cult were destroyed. And a sorcerous staff recovered as well... even these pirates wanted nothing to do with that!
ADDENDUM 1: I've never liked a Greenskin more than at the time of this report.
ADDENDUM 2: The Inquisition has now been informed. The days may get darker yet.
ADDENDUM 3: We can now add a new Freebooter Clan to roster of available resources.
